The Magic of Brazilian Football
Brazilian football, or futebol, is more than just a sport; it's a cultural phenomenon. Known for its flair, creativity, and passion, Brazil has consistently produced some of the greatest players in the history of the game. Names like Pelé, Zico, Ronaldo, Ronaldinho, and Neymar are synonymous with football excellence. But what makes Brazilian football so special? It's the unique blend of skill, improvisation, and a deep-rooted love for the game that sets it apart.
The history of Brazilian football is rich and storied. Brazil has won the FIFA World Cup a record five times (1958, 1962, 1970, 1994, and 2002), cementing its place as a footballing powerhouse. Each victory has added to the nation's footballing identity, inspiring generations of players and fans. The iconic yellow jersey, the samba-inspired celebrations, and the sheer joy of playing â these are the hallmarks of Brazilian football.
But it's not just about winning trophies. The Brazilian style of play is characterized by its attacking intent, technical brilliance, and individual expression. Players are encouraged to take risks, showcase their skills, and play with freedom. This philosophy has led to some of the most unforgettable moments in football history. Think of PelĂ©'s mesmerizing dribbles, Zico's pinpoint passes, or Ronaldinho's audacious flicks â these are the moments that define Brazilian football.
Off the pitch, football is deeply ingrained in Brazilian society. From the bustling streets of Rio de Janeiro to the remote villages in the Amazon, football is a unifying force. It brings people together, transcends social barriers, and provides a sense of national pride. Every match is a celebration, a chance to express the passion and love for the game. And when Brazil plays, the entire nation comes to a standstill, united in support of their beloved team.

Standout Players
No discussion of Brazilian football highlights would be complete without mentioning the standout players. These are the individuals who consistently deliver moments of magic, inspire their teammates, and captivate fans around the world. Here are some of the players who have been making waves in recent matches:
- 
Neymar Jr.: Arguably the biggest name in Brazilian football today, Neymar Jr. is a global superstar known for his dazzling dribbling skills, creative playmaking, and clinical finishing. He is the heart and soul of the Brazilian team, and his performances often dictate the outcome of matches. In recent games, Neymar has been in sensational form, scoring goals, providing assists, and creating countless opportunities for his teammates.
 - 
VinĂcius JĂșnior: One of the rising stars of Brazilian football, VinĂcius JĂșnior is a dynamic and explosive winger with a knack for taking on defenders. His pace, skill, and determination make him a constant threat to opposing teams. In recent matches, VinĂcius has been showcasing his talent, scoring crucial goals and providing a spark of creativity to the Brazilian attack.
 - 
Casemiro: A rock in the Brazilian midfield, Casemiro is a defensive powerhouse known for his tackling, interceptions, and work rate. He provides the team with stability and protection, allowing the attacking players to express themselves freely. Casemiro's leadership and experience are invaluable to the Brazilian team, and he is often the unsung hero of their success.
 - 
Alisson Becker: One of the best goalkeepers in the world, Alisson Becker is a reliable and consistent presence between the posts. His shot-stopping ability, command of the area, and distribution skills make him a vital asset to the Brazilian team. In recent matches, Alisson has made some crucial saves, preserving leads and keeping his team in the game.
